About Julie Seibt

Julie Seibt is a scholar working on Cellular and Molecular Neuroscience, Cognitive Neuroscience and Toxicology, having authored 19 papers that have together received 1.3k indexed citations. Recurring topics across this work include Neuroscience and Neuropharmacology Research (14 papers), Sleep and Wakefulness Research (12 papers) and Neural dynamics and brain function (5 papers). The work is most often cited by research in Developmental Neuroscience (268 citations), Cognitive Neuroscience (737 citations) and Cellular and Molecular Neuroscience (657 citations). Julie Seibt has collaborated with scholars based in United States, United Kingdom and Germany. Frequent co-authors include Marcos G. Frank, Sara J. Aton, Tammi Coleman, Michelle Dumoulin, Nirinjini Naidoo, François Guillemot, Carol Schuurmans, Franck Polleux, Adrien Peyrache and Sushil K. Jha. Their work appears in journals such as Proceedings of the National Academy of Sciences, Nature Communications and Neuron.
